Medical Coverage & Repatriation: The Core Protection You Need Abroad
Extensive Medical Expense Limits
Medical emergencies abroad carry eye-watering costs. Europ Assistance addresses this with coverage up to €750,000 within Europe and €1,250,000 worldwide per person per event. These figures represent genuine financial security—they're not marketing numbers, but actual limits that cover hospitalization, emergency treatment, specialist consultations, and diagnostic procedures at private hospitals across covered regions.
Repatriation & Early Return Services
The policy guarantees full medical repatriation services, ensuring your return to your home country if hospitalization occurs while traveling. Beyond this, early return provisions activate when serious illness or death occurs at home, allowing family members to leave their trip immediately without financial penalty. Beyond Basic Coverage: Specialized Protection for Adventurous Travelers
Ski Assistance & Mountain Safety
For winter sports enthusiasts, ski assistance covers both on-piste and off-piste incidents with dedicated alpine rescue coordination. This specialized protection extends to search and rescue cost coverage up to €5,000 for mountain and wilderness emergencies—critical for hikers, mountaineers, and backcountry explorers.
Natural Disaster Extensions & Adventure Add-Ons
Natural disaster extension of stay benefits activate when unforeseen events prevent travel, protecting you from stranded situations without accruing additional hotel costs. High-risk activities like climbing or extreme sports require specific adventure sports add-ons, but these options exist for travelers who refuse to compromise their pursuits for insurance limitations.
Financial Protection for Trip Disruptions & Unexpected Losses
Compensation for Unused Travel Days
Unused travel day compensation reaches €2,500 per insured person per trip, with a maximum combined payout of €12,500 for all insured persons on a single trip. This protection activates when illness, injury, or other covered events force you to abandon your journey.
Luggage & Cancellation Coverage
Comprehensive plans like Traveller Plus include luggage loss, theft, and damage coverage up to €1,500. Cancellation insurance add-ons protect prepaid trip costs, and pre-existing condition coverage options exist for those with chronic health concerns requiring declaration.
Annual vs. Single-Trip: Why Frequent Travelers Choose Europ Assistance
Annual policies eliminate the repetitive enrollment headache that plagues frequent travelers. Rather than purchasing coverage for each journey, you gain continuous protection from purchase through the 12-month period. This structure becomes cost-effective for anyone taking 3+ international trips annually—the math simply favors annual policies over multiple single-trip purchases.
Simplified claims processes across all trips under one policy number streamline administration. You're not juggling separate documentation or policy numbers; everything ties to a single annual contract, reducing confusion and administrative friction.

The Claims Reality: What Customers Experience When Filing for Benefits
Documentation Requirements & Processing Timelines
Claims processing demands extensive documentation and proof of expenses. Medical receipts, invoices, proof of payment, and circumstantial evidence all contribute to claim packages that often span dozens of pages. Reimbursement timelines range from weeks to months depending on claim complexity—straightforward medical expenses move faster, while disputed claims involving judgment calls about coverage drag considerably longer.
Customer Service Accessibility Concerns
Multiple customer reviews flag accessibility issues during peak hours and emergency situations. Reaching human representatives during emergencies proves difficult, sometimes forcing travelers to pay out-of-pocket initially and claim reimbursement later. This creates obvious friction when facing hospitalization costs that demand immediate payment.
Denial Rates & Policy Interpretation Disputes
Claims denial rates run higher than industry averages for certain claim types. Some customers report denials citing "invalid reasons" or policy interpretation disputes, suggesting inconsistency in how Europ Assistance applies coverage terms. This unpredictability introduces legitimate concern about whether your specific claim will receive approval.

Pricing Structure & Plan Options for Different Traveler Profiles
Entry-Level & Annual Options
Entry-level Traveller plans start from €9 for basic single-trip coverage, while the Annual Multi-Trip Premium policy sits at approximately €152 annually. Pricing varies based on age, destination region, and coverage level selected. Optional add-ons—cancellation, pre-existing conditions, adventure sports—increase costs incrementally.
For travelers taking multiple trips annually, the €152 annual premium represents exceptional value when amortized across three or more journeys. Single-trip alternatives cost more when purchased repeatedly, making the annual approach financially sensible for active explorers.
